About you

  • You have 5-7 years of experience working in similar customer-facing roles at a software as a service business. You’re confident with queue work and you have a unique toolkit that would allow you to get up-to-speed quickly. Bonus points if you’ve worked at a healthcare technology company.
  • You’d consider yourself a full-spectrum generalist with a strong foundational understanding of things like: single sign-on, billing and invoicing, modern browsers (plus developer tools) and mobile operating systems, email deliverability, DNS records, reading log files of any kind. Overall, you’re more technical than the typical support professional.
  • You have to be an excellent writer. You’re someone who can take complex subjects and break them down using clear and simple language. As a remote team, your writing and communication skills are critical to your success.
  • You are organized and self-sufficient. You thrive in an environment where you can do great work independently. You’re someone who enjoys working autonomously and you don’t need much oversight to get things done.
  • When you don’t know something, you try to figure it out. You ask good questions, and you embrace the chance to grow and get better. You are a great problem-solver with the ability to process and resolve issues quickly.
  • You’re well-versed in the tools of the trade. We use Help Scout, Stripe, Sendgrid, Mixpanel, Guru, and Notion to help serve our customers.
  • This isn’t a stepping stone to another team at Healthie. You want to be part of our support team for a while, and you’re excited to continue to sharpen your skills in a customer-facing position.

How to apply 

Please submit a PDF cover letter explaining:

  • Who are you? Why do you want this job at Healthie?
  • Where are you based and what time zone are you in?
  • Why do you work in customer support?

In your cover letter, pretend you’ve got the job and answer these customer scenarios as if you worked here:

  • A customer is requesting a feature we don’t currently support, and we don’t know if we’re going to build it out in the future.
  • A customer signs in to Healthie and reports that the only thing they see on the screen is the left-hand sidebar. Everything else seems to be missing or doesn’t appear to be loading.
  • You’re working with a customer who is upset about pricing and wants a discount. In this case we’re not able to offer a discount.
  • You’re answering complex questions and going back and forth troubleshooting with a VIP customer. It’s starting to feel like you’re going in circles, and you’ve hit a wall with your own understanding. The customer is waiting on you for next steps.
